Police Find Missing Conover Infant In Davie County

CONOVER, N.C. -- Police found a missing 2-month-old girl from Conover early Monday morning, but the man accused of taking her was still on the loose, police said.The amber alert was issued Sunday night for Catalin Hoard after she was abducted from her home on Herman Sipe Road in Catawba County.Officers found Hoard after a police chase in Davie County.The suspect, 37-year-old Saturnino Ortega-Vidal, jumped out of the truck and ran off, police said.Ortega-Vidal had been living with Hoard's mother but he got drunk, fought with the mother and then took off with the baby, according to police.He will be charged with kidnapping and assault.
